As a resident of New Castle, NH, what types of immigration cases do local attorneys typically handle?
Immigration attorneys serving New Castle, NH, commonly handle cases relevant to the Seacoast region's demographics, including family-based petitions for spouses and children, employment-based visas for professionals at nearby Portsmouth Naval Shipyard or tech companies, and naturalization applications. Given New Castle's proximity to the coast and Portsmouth, they also frequently assist with maritime worker visas (H-2B) for the hospitality and marine industries, as well as investor visas (E-2) for those looking to start businesses in the area. They are well-versed in navigating both USCIS procedures and the specific logistical considerations of clients in a smaller New England town.

Are there immigration law firms physically located in New Castle, NH, or will I need to travel?
Given New Castle's very small population (under 1,000), it is unlikely you will find a law firm physically located within the town limits. However, numerous experienced immigration attorneys practice in the immediate Greater Portsmouth area, including Portsmouth itself, which is just across the bridge. These nearby attorneys are easily accessible to New Castle residents and are fully equipped to serve clients in Rockingham County. Many offer initial consultations via phone or video conference to minimize travel, and they are familiar with the local courts and government offices you may need to visit.
What should I look for when choosing an immigration attorney in the New Castle, NH area?
When choosing an immigration attorney near New Castle, NH, prioritize those with extensive experience in your specific visa category and a proven track record with New England immigration courts and USCIS offices. Look for attorneys who are members of the American Immigration Lawyers Association (AILA) and have positive client reviews from the Seacoast region. It is also beneficial to select a lawyer familiar with New Hampshire state law nuances, such as those affecting notarization, marriage licenses for immigration purposes, and any local policies in Portsmouth or Rockingham County that could impact your case.
